Stepping into Frant train station, passengers find a straightforward ticketing experience. The ticket office operates every weekday morning from 06:25 to 09:45, while ticket machines are available for convenient, anytime service. For those with accessibility needs, step-free access is partially available, and accessible ticket machines are strategically placed at platform 2. While the station lacks a waiting room, there is ample seating for commuters.
On the safety front, Frant station boasts CCTV coverage, and it has attained a Secure Station accreditation, underscoring its commitment to passenger security. However, note that facilities such as toilets, refreshment services, or shops are currently absent. The station encourages those who cycle to take advantage of its 12 bicycle storage spaces, though it's imperative to consider the risks as no CCTV covers these areas.
Frant station ensures that passengers are not only connected via train but also have access to comprehensive onward travel options. Rail replacement bus services are thoughtfully arranged for those traveling towards Tunbridge Wells/Tonbridge and Wadhurst, making transitions smoother even during service interruptions. Travelers can also plan further journeys with printed information on bus services readily available—helpful for those looking to explore the local area by road as well as rail.

Conisbrough Station may not boast a bustling array of services, but it efficiently meets essential travel needs. Despite the absence of a ticket office, travelers can conveniently collect pre-purchased tickets from the station's accessible ticket machines. The station also features an induction loop for passengers who are hearing impaired. However, if you need any support, please note there is no staff help available directly at Conisbrough. Alternatively, you can reach out through the helpline at 08002006060 for assistance.
Access to the platforms is generally step-free, characterized as a Category B station with ramped entry. While there are no facilities for refreshments, shops, or ATMs on the premises, the station does offer a CCTV-monitored area for bicycle storage, complete with shelters and stands for up to 10 bikes. Convenient parking is available via a Northern-operated car park that provides free parking around the clock.
Finding your next transport option at Conisbrough couldn't be easier. With rail replacement services picking up and dropping off at the top of the station approach road, the transition between train and bus services is seamless. Regular bus services operate nearby; just a short walk will connect you with further local transit options. If you prefer a more direct route, taxis are a viable choice, particularly with services like Cab 4 You, providing excellent local cab links.
